On Feb 24, 2008, at 12:46 PM, Bill Nash wrote:
The bgp mib doesn't contain an object to tell you, summarized, how many prefixes a peer is sending
No, but the BGP4+ MIB does... different vendors implemented that MIB early with differing OIDs :( Support for the correct OID is, er, sadly lacking in common versions of popular routing OSen.
